Ryan Jarrett

American tie-down roper (born 1983)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Ryan Jarrett (born December 28, 1983), is an American professional rodeo cowboy who specializes in tie-down roping and competes in the Professional Rodeo Cowboys Association (PRCA) circuit.[1] At the 2005 National Finals Rodeo (NFR), he won the PRCA All-Around world championship.[1] He competed in steer wrestling, tie-down roping, and team roping during the season and at the NFR to win the title.[1]

He was inducted into the Rodeo Hall of Fame of the National Cowboy and Western Heritage Museum in 2010.[2]
